In a powerful and resonant social media statement, prominent South African artist Kraizie has stepped forward to address the recent highly publicized controversy involving fellow hip-hop artist Emtee. The controversy, which has sent ripples across the South African music scene, stemmed from a public declaration by Emtee’s wife, Kendall Chinsamy, who explicitly called her husband a “gay bitch.” Kraizie’s intervention comes as a significant call for dignity, unity, and kindness within an industry often fraught with personal disputes playing out in the public eye.
